Eren Bilen (born 2 December 2000) is a Turkish footballer who plays as a goalkeeper for Darıca Gençlerbirliği on loan from Kocaelispor.
Bilen made his professional debut with Göztepe in a 3-3 Turkish Cup tie with Antalyaspor on 15 January 2019.[1]
